CVE-2025-27379
Last modified
CVE-2025-27379 is a medium-severity vulnerability rated 4.6/10 on the CVSS scale. A stored c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in the BOM Viewer in Altium AES 7.0.3 allows an authenticated attacker to inject arbitrary JavaScript into the Description field of a schematic, which is executed when the BOM Viewer renders the affected content.. EPSS estimates a 0.20%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.

Affected Software
| Vendor | Product | Versions |
|---|---|---|
| Altium | On-Prem Enterprise Server | >= 7.0.3, < 7.0.6 |
